Vilnius police have detained a man who allegedly drew crayons on the installation of the ShIZO cell of politician Alexei Navalny. It is reported by the publication Delfi.
On the night of July 28, the inscription Navalnists for the terrorist Girkin. An arrow was drawn in chalk on the pavement with another inscription — «Parasha Girkin«.
Vilnius police reported that the detained man was born in 1974. He is charged with violating public order.
Sota writes that the activist of the Peaceful Resistance movement, Russian Mikhail Baranov, fits the description. As the newspaper notes, the man had previously been seen at protests against associates of Alexei Navalny. Baranov confirmed on his Facebook that it was he who painted the installation and was detained by the police.
Members of the «Peaceful Resistance» claimed responsibility for other attacks on a full-size mock-up of Navalny's punishment cell, which was opened on Europe Square in Vilnius on 5 July. On the night of July 6-7, unknown people tried to set fire to it, pouring fuel over the outside of the wall. And on the night of July 11, the installation was wrapped in black film.
A full-size model of the ShIZO cell in Vladimir IK-6, where Navalny has been regularly placed for the last year, was made by his brother Oleg Navalny. The politician’s associates exhibited this work in seven European countries, so that anyone could understand the conditions under which the oppositionist is being held.
